The majestic structures of ancient civilizations have long fascinated us, and the pyramid is a symbol of engineering prowess and architectural ingenuity. Recently, the volume of these ancient wonders has been gaining attention in the US, sparking curiosity among historians, architects, and enthusiasts alike. In this article, we'll delve into the world of pyramid volume, exploring its significance, calculation, and impact.
Calculating the volume of a pyramid involves determining its base area and height, then multiplying these values by a specific formula. The formula for the volume of a pyramid is:

The largest pyramid in the world is the Great Pyramid of Giza in Egypt, with an original height of 146.5 meters and a base area of 13,008 square meters.
Volume = (Base Area x Height) / 3

Pyramid volume calculations inform modern engineering designs, particularly in the fields of architecture, civil engineering, and construction. Understanding how pyramids distribute loads and stress can improve the structural integrity of modern buildings.
